Be prepared for a lot of noise, mess, and responsibility. Sun conures are NOISY, they are MESSY, and they need a LOT of attention. Especially coming from a different home, you will need to put in a lot of work to build a trusting bond between you guys. Parrots get very attached to owners, and also sometimes decide to hate someone for no good reason. In an apartment setting, I would not ever consider one as it can and will be heard in the other apartments neighboring you - not cool. They can make great pets, but all I am saying is they require a lot of work than many busy people cannot provide. Seed is also an inadequate and incomplete diet, so be ready to spend a decent amount of money providing a fresh and varied diet in addition to seed.
